Mert Alas, born in Turkey, and Marcus Piggott, born in Wales, met in 1994, at a party on a pier in Hastings, England. Piggott asked Alas for a light, the pair got talking, and rapidly discovered they had plenty in common, not least a love of fashion. Three years later, the duo now known as Mert and Marcus had moved into a derelict loft in East London, converted it into a studio, and had their first collaborative photographic work published in Dazed & Confused.These days, Mert and Marcus shape the global image of such renowned brands as Giorgio Armani, Roberto Cavalli, Fendi, Miu Miu, Gucci, Yves Saint Laurent, Givenchy, and Lancome, and public figures including Lady Gaga, Madonna, Jennifer Lopez, Linda Evangelista, Gisele Bundchen, Bjoerk, Angelina Jolie, and Rihanna. Their photographs encompass a wide range of styles and influences but are renowned particularly for their use of digitized augmentation of images, and a fascination for strong, sexually charged, confident female subjects: "powerful women, women with a meaning, a you-don't-have-to-talk-or-move-too-much-to-tell-who-you-are kind of woman."Bringing our best-selling Collector's Edition to an affordable, compact format, this collection explores the unique vision of a creative partnership that has defined and redefined standards for glamour, fashion, and luxury. Approximately 300 images from the megawatt Mert and Marcus portfolio are accompanied by an introduction by Charlotte Cotton.First published as a TASCHEN Collector's Edition, now available as an affordable, compact editionmehr

ZusammenfassungDie Liste der Klienten von Mert & Marcus liest sich wie ein Who's Who der Modebranche und internationalen Celebrity-Welt. Givenchy, Gucci, Yves Saint Laurent, Calvin Klein, Louis Vuitton, Armani, Madonna, Kate Moss, J. Lo, Gisele Bündchen - M&M machen Schönes noch schöner. Dieser verkleinerte Nachdruck unserer erfolgreichen Collector's Edition zeigt auf 408 Seiten rund 300 Bilder aus dem hyperglamourösen Repertoire der beiden Szenelieblinge, die die Fashionfotografie neu definiert haben.

Charlotte Cotton ist Kuratorin und Autorin. Sie leitete den Wallis-Annenberg-Fachbereich Fotografie am Los Angeles County Museum of Art (2007-2009), war Kuratorin für Fotografie am Victoria and Albert Museum (1992-2004) und war Programmleiterin der Londoner Photographers Gallery (2004-2005). Zudem ist sie Gründungsredakteurin von wordswithoutpictures.org.
